Breaded eggplant layered with marinara and melted mozzarella.

Why this fits a diabetes-friendly diet
At 34g of carbs per serving, it's worth pairing with protein or fat and watching portion size to keep the resulting blood sugar rise gradual, and its estimated glycemic index of ~45 means the carbs it does have tend to digest slowly rather than spiking blood sugar fast, and 6g of fiber per serving adds the same slowing effect.
Ingredients
- 3 cup710 ml eggplant
- 1/2 cup120 ml whole wheat breadcrumbs
- 1 large1 large eggs
- 1 1/2 cup355 ml low-sodium marinara sauce
- 3/4 cup175 ml part-skim mozzarella
- 3 tbsp45 ml parmesan cheese
- 1 tbsp15 ml olive oil
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Slice eggplant; dip in beaten egg, then breadcrumbs.
- Arrange on an oiled baking sheet and bake 15 minutes, flipping halfway.
- Layer eggplant with marinara and mozzarella in a baking dish.
- Top with parmesan and bake 15 more minutes until bubbly.
